WebShulman suggests that these sources of understanding make possible the pro-cess of pedagogical reasoning and action. The model describes how a teacher's understanding of subject matter is trans-formed to make it 'teachable'. This pro-cess of transformation taps the different sources of knowledge, the most important being pedagogical content ...
